Output 16b255db72e727ed2fb5fdca0a61b133b73806164f44a7a697edc4d0646af9ee:1

value
261155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ec543d5d35a24acb6eec55b9517087e0ddabb20c OP_EQUAL
address
3PEcJtk7pEHSw14nKc2D3ao8joCH44Exm7
transaction
16b255db72e727ed2fb5fdca0a61b133b73806164f44a7a697edc4d0646af9ee
confirmations
150987
spent
true